从单轮对话到复杂场景的人工智能对话实现
随着科技的不断发展,人工智能在各个领域都取得了显著的成果。其中,人工智能对话系统的发展尤为引人注目。从单轮对话到复杂场景的人工智能对话实现,不仅展示了人工智能技术的进步,也极大地丰富了人类与机器的互动方式。本文将讲述一位人工智能对话系统开发者的故事,展现他从单轮对话到复杂场景的人工智能对话实现的心路历程。
这位开发者名叫李明,他从小就对计算机科学产生了浓厚的兴趣。在大学期间,他选择了人工智能专业,立志要为人工智能技术的发展贡献自己的力量。毕业后,李明进入了一家知名的人工智能公司,开始了他的职业生涯。
刚开始,李明负责的是单轮对话系统的开发。这种系统只能处理简单的、结构化的对话,如问答、命令执行等。尽管这个阶段的任务相对简单,但李明深知单轮对话系统是复杂场景对话系统的基础。因此,他全身心地投入到单轮对话系统的开发中,努力提高系统的准确性和效率。
在李明的努力下,单轮对话系统逐渐趋于成熟。然而,他并没有满足于此。李明意识到,单轮对话系统在处理复杂场景时存在诸多不足,如无法理解用户的意图、无法处理自然语言中的歧义等。为了解决这些问题,李明开始研究复杂场景的人工智能对话实现。
复杂场景的人工智能对话实现需要解决以下几个关键问题:
意图识别:如何让系统准确地理解用户的意图,是复杂场景对话实现的关键。为此,李明研究了多种意图识别算法,如基于规则的方法、基于机器学习的方法等。通过不断优化算法,他成功地提高了系统的意图识别准确率。
命名实体识别:在复杂场景中,用户可能会提到一些特定的实体,如人名、地名、组织名等。如何让系统准确地识别这些实体,是提高对话系统性能的关键。李明通过研究命名实体识别技术,实现了对实体的高效识别。
上下文理解:在复杂场景中,用户的对话往往包含丰富的上下文信息。如何让系统理解这些上下文信息,是提高对话系统自然度的重要途径。李明通过研究上下文理解技术,实现了对对话上下文的准确把握。
生成式对话:在复杂场景中,系统需要根据用户的输入生成合适的回复。生成式对话技术是实现这一目标的关键。李明研究了多种生成式对话技术,如基于模板的方法、基于深度学习的方法等。通过不断优化算法,他成功地提高了系统的回复质量。
在解决了上述关键问题后,李明开始着手开发复杂场景的人工智能对话系统。他首先从简单的场景入手,如餐厅预订、机票查询等。在积累了丰富的经验后,他逐步将系统应用于更加复杂的场景,如智能家居、医疗咨询等。
在这个过程中,李明遇到了许多困难和挑战。有时,他为了解决一个技术难题,需要查阅大量的文献、请教专家,甚至加班加点。然而,正是这些挑战和困难,让李明更加坚定了实现复杂场景人工智能对话系统的信念。
经过数年的努力,李明终于成功开发出一套具有较高性能的复杂场景人工智能对话系统。这套系统不仅可以理解用户的意图,还能根据上下文信息生成合适的回复,甚至能够根据用户的反馈不断优化自己的对话能力。
如今,李明的成果已经得到了业界的认可。他的复杂场景人工智能对话系统被广泛应用于各个领域,为人们的生活带来了极大的便利。而李明本人也成为了人工智能对话领域的佼佼者。
回顾李明的成长历程,我们可以看到他从单轮对话到复杂场景的人工智能对话实现的心路历程。正是这种坚持不懈、勇于创新的精神,让他取得了如此辉煌的成就。相信在不久的将来,人工智能对话技术将会更加成熟,为人类带来更多惊喜。
猜你喜欢:AI实时语音